Today’s Speaker:  Chris Pinchbeck came to talk about Scottish bag pipes.  Chris makes authentic Scottish Small Pipes in addition to teaching an on-line photography course and owns a “cut your own” Christmas tree farm.
Chris explained that there are over 200 different types of bagpipes.  The most common bagpipe is the great Highland Pipe which was used in war to lead the troops out into battle and to intimidate the enemy.  Chris also showed us a few different types of pipes as well.  He then went on to describe the Scottish Small Pipes and how they are made.  He described the parts of the bag pipe and how they are played.  He played a few tunes for us and it was most enjoyable.
 
The Scottish small pipe is quieter and gentler, better for inside and more intimate settings.  They are made out of many types of woods and it takes about a year to make a set of bagpipes from start to finish.  Chris makes every part except for the Bellows.  Chris has a two year waiting list for pipes and they are ordered from people all over the world. 
Chris’s musical career started with the saxophone and then his grandfather sent a set of pipes to him as a younger man.  He played with Rocky Bay Pipe and Drums band in the mid-coast area.  He eventually taught himself how to make the pipes after buying a set that broke down and he started to work on it.  18 years later he produced his first set.   Thank you Chris for a great presentation.
